To avoid damaging seals remove cap and rod. Even reseal ram as its now off and you know it will be good for ages.Braze needs to be removed completly if electric welding.I would melt off old braze, check metal pipe is in sound condition.Give the welded area a good clean and rebraze using flux coated rods.With eletric welding, I would say its not a good job to take on if you have little experience.If not welded correctly you may have pin holes in the weld.I would say in this case,I would braze it.If you don't feel confident in yourself to do it yourself.There may be a firm local to you that will do it for you.Good luck :thumbup:
